A local government authority is seeking a Cleaning Operative 2 for Watten Primary School. This is a permanent part-time position with 10 hours per week. The role involves ensuring cleanliness and hygiene in designated areas as per set standards. The successful candidate will earn between £5,891 and £5,958 annually.
Applicants must meet specific eligibility criteria, including nationality and possible Overseas Criminal Record Check requirements. The position promotes equality and welcomes applications from diverse backgrounds.
